Senior IPS officer Sonia Narang has been appointed as Inspector General (IG) of the Central Industrial Security Force (CISF) until April 6, 2026. A 2002 batch IPS officer of the Karnataka cadre, her appointment comes by temporarily upgrading the vacant post of DIG to IG rank in CISF. Narang’s leadership is expected to strengthen the security framework of India’s vital industrial and strategic installations.
